Pointe class may be taken by students who are not yet on pointe to further develop and strengthen the muscles necessary to go on pointe.  Students who are on pointe must take at least two additional ballet classes per week. Readiness for pointe work is determined by each student’s strength and physical development, not by their age. The instructor will advise parents when a student has the necessary strength and maturity to go on pointe. Pointe class may be taken only with the permission of the instructor.

 

All of our pointe/pre-pointe classes stress correct placement (body alignment), and correct classical ballet technique. Class level is determined by the instructor and is based on an individual assessment when the student takes a trial class. All students receive corrections during class to help them advance. Students advance to the next level based on the recommendation of the instructor. No students can go into pointe shoes without approval from the teacher and after an assessment from the physical therapist.

Pointe Assessment

All students wanting to go on to pointe must also be assessed by a licensed physical therapist for adequate strength and balances and physical structure of the student. We require this for the protection of the student. We want to make sure they are 100% ready for this major transition and want them to do this in a safe manner.
